Rate studies on deprotonation of a simple ketone (R-2,2,6-trimethylcyclohexanone) with lithium diisopropylamide are described. The data are consistent with the reaction being first order in ketone and half order in the base, corresponding to the rate equation: v = k[ketone][LDA](1/2). (C) 1998 Elsevier Science Ltd.
